Music: Tuners & Tuning

War Manpower Boss McNutt does not consider piano tuning a war-essential industry. But in Alaska, where piano tuners are next to nonexistent, an obscure master of this peaceful craft is doing his not inconsiderable bit to help the war effort.

Last week Harry J. Baker was in Matanuska, while officers at army posts and naval bases throughout the territory clamored for his services.
